About the role:

This RN role is responsible for providing nursing care to patients receiving Radiotherapy and will report to the Nurse Manager. The role involves assessing, reviewing and implementing care plans to patients receiving treatment.

The Nursing role has a great level of autonomy, while still working within a close and supportive team. It is a greatly rewarding role which provides great opportunities to build positive rapports with our patients.

The role of a Registered Nurse at Icon is invaluable, through clinically assessing, providing education, supporting patients with physical side effects, emotional support and referrals to allied health.

Key Responsibilities: 
  • Provision of patient centred radiation oncology cancer care to our patients and their families, ensuring an empathetic approach to patients needs are met in a timely manner.
  • Monitor and treat patients for illness, lymphoedema or other side effects.
  • Maintain standards by ensuring best practice protocols and clinical guidelines are implemented and followed.
  • Contribute expert advice and demonstrate contemporary nursing knowledge and skill in oncology nursing practice in accordance with current legislation and professional standards and codes of practice
  • Support the Nurse Manager in the day to day operations
  • Support implementation of new systems, therapies and clinical trials.

Who are we?

Icon Group is Australia’s largest dedicated cancer care provider and has expanded globally into Singapore, Mainland China, Hong Kong and New Zealand. We are built on a strong but simple vision – to deliver the best care possible, to as many people as possible, as close to home as possible.
